PURPOSE:To atomize fuel, by a method wherein the forward end of a cylindrical nozzle is closed, a projecting slanted part is formed on the inner peripheral surface of the forward end, and when the fuel is injected in a thread like manner through a plurality of fuel flow-out passages, an air flow, simultaneously, is caused to cross the fuel at right angles. CONSTITUTION:Two types of fuels, supplied through fuel passages 2 and 2' for fuel installed along the direction of an axis at the inside of a cylindrical nozzle 1, are injected in a thread like manner through a plurality of fuel flow-out passages 4 and 4', which have the forward end blocked with a projecting part 3 and are formed facing on the about identical periphery of a projecting slanted part, and cross the flow of the air fed from the inside 5 of a cylinder about at right angles and are split in a spray manner for atomization. The fuel, adhered to the inner wall surface of the nozzle, is raised in a film manner along projecting slanted parts 6, 6', and 6'', makes contact with the air flow at the top part, and are split in a film manner and atomized for combustion. C heavey oil, which is hard to atomize by means of a low pressure air, can be excellently burnt by a geometrical effect with atomization by expansion of water, making contact with oil, and a water gas reaction without generation of black smoke simultaneously with emulsion combustion. |
